Kurimanzutto started as a low-budget itinerant art space created to promote young Mexican talent at home and abroad. For a while, the owner’s apartment was all the space they had to exhibit the art. Nowadays Kurimanzutto sits on a large space in a leafy residential area of Mexico City and represents over 30 global artists. One of Mexico City’s top art destinations. (https://ausoma.org/)
